SimplyDanny wrote:
Added option with two tests. It's very strict though. As soon as an element in
a list stems from a macro, it will be ignored. Not sure how to check whether a
macro describes a whole expression or list element, because these cases would
be fine, e.g.
```c++
#define A (3+2)
#define B .j=1
S s {A, B};
```
